Intel Acceleration Stack快速入门指南: Intel FPGA Programmable Acceleration Card D5005

ID 683394
日期 9/09/2020
Public
文档目录

7.1. 更新VF所需的设置

要使用SR-IOV并将VF传递给虚拟机,必须在主机上使能Intel IOMMU驱动器。请按照以下步骤使能Intel IOMMU驱动器:

  1. 通过更新GRUB配置文件,将intel_iommu=on添加到GRUB_CMDLINE_LINUX条目中。
  2. GRUB从传统的基于BIOS机器上的/boot/grub2/grub.cfg文件读取其配置,或者从UEFI机器上的/boot/efi/EFI/redhat/grub.cfg文件文件读取其配置。根据您的系统,执行以下其中一个指令:
    • 基于BIOS的机器:
      grub2-mkconfig -o /boot/grub2/grub.cfg
    • 基于UEFI的机器:
      grub2-mkconfig -o /boot/efi/EFI/redhat/grub.cfg
  3. 重新启动以应用新的GRUB配置文件。
  4. 请运行以下命令对GRUB更新进行验证:
    cat /proc/cmdline
    以下样例输出在内核命令行上显示 intel_iommu=on

    样例输出:

    BOOT_IMAGE=/vmlinuz-3.10.0-514.21.1.el7.x86_64 
    root=/dev/mapper/cl_<server_name>-root ro intel_iommu=on 
    crashkernel=auto rd.lvm.lv=cl_<server_name>/root 
    rd.lvm.lv=cl_<server_name>/swap rhgb quiet